Transaction 6320a869c55e05b5ffc9ae4f6b980047eb5ee3eaadc287a81dfcc4ca98483929
1 Input
1 Output
-
6320a869c55e05b5ffc9ae4f6b980047eb5ee3eaadc287a81dfcc4ca98483929:0
- value
- 44925692
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 39842f73bfb4c12fc0ac0a737015f004658807f0 OP_EQUAL
- address
- 36w8nssYLeEPp8HK1qJoLCbvqgBvU2AWDC